KIRKLANDS

OF SYDNEY, E. H . KEATES, MASTER, BURTHEN 1186 TONS
FROM THE PORT OF FREMANTLE TO SYDNEY, NEW SOUTH WALES, 12TH DEC 1896

Source: State Records Authority of New South Wales: Shipping Master's Office; Passengers Arriving 1855 - 1922; NRS13278, [X243 -X244] reel 536.   Transcribed by Tamea Willcocks. Proofread by Gloria Sheehan
